About HBK
HBK Capital Management is an alternative investment firm currently managing nearly $8 billion in assets. The firm was founded in 1991 and employs approximately 200 individuals in Dallas, New York, London, and Charlottesville. Job Description
HBK is searching for an Associate to join our energetic and collaborative Investor Relations team in Dallas. This team is responsible for building and managing the relationships with HBK’s investors, which include public pensions, endowments and other institutional investors.
The candidate will report to the co-Heads of Investor Relations and will provide essential administrative and operational support to the IR team. This role is ideal for a detail-oriented and highly organized individual who thrives in a fast-paced environment and is comfortable handling a variety of tasks to support the team’s client service and investor communication efforts. The Associate will provide a range of fund-related information to investors and maintaining the department’s investor and prospect database. The individual will also support senior marketing members of the team, including notetaking and assisting with investor/prospect follow up.
The ideal candidate will be a proactive problem solver with strong communication skills and the 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ously. This person will work closely with the Investor Relations team and other departments to ensure smooth day-to-day operations and effective investor engagement.
